Because of the proliferation of low-cost remanufactured printers cartridges, a lot of printer owners have gone to these as alternatives to getting original cartridges. Yet, manufacturers are cautioning against the luster of inexpensive ink printer cartridges.

Printer companies such as Epson released up to date reports that bear out the disadvantages of rebuilt printer cartridges. A quality check known as QualityLogic disclosed that 25% of recycled cartridge for printer go down instantly after setting up. This percentage furthermore includes those that are discovered to be not working after meticulous going over. With original inkjet printer ink cartridges, the reports resulted in 0% cartridge breakdown frequency. Standalone study what’s more supports the superior value and tolerability of copies made by original cartridges. Whilst a overwhelming 25% of prints from rebuilt cartridges was determined intolerable, a meager 2% of HP’s prints were considered in the similar category. 98% of the time, you obtain the print value you deserve by using original cartridges. This as well spares you from reprinting deficient prints, thus saving you a considerable quantity of time, paper and cash. The original printers cartridges also employ ground-breaking ink systems and print head technologies that may not be there in generic types of cartridge.

Whilst remanufactured cartridges may give you quick-fix discounts, they can prove to be a liability to you in the long run. Aside from creating low-quality prints, they could also produce clogging and leaking troubles that may perhaps considerably lower your printer’s economic life.
